Main character is a normal high school student who gets into an accident at the construction site. Instead of dying he finds himself in a strange world. There he learns that he needs to find a powerful artifact in order to return to his world. However, there are also other contestants for the treasure as it can help to conquer the world. Will protagonist return to his world safely? The primary objective of this game is to plan training schedules for yourself and the four members of your party, including you, to strengthen them. You must win several board game battles that occur during the journey. Additionally, by forming close bonds with the girls you recruit as allies, you can receive a confession of love from them in the ending (if you fail to build a good rapport with any party member, you will receive a confession from one of the rival characters, Kyle, Remit, or Iris). These romantic elements are secondary objectives. There are a total of 27 different endings in the game. This game can be considered a precursor to MediaWorks' Yuukyuu Gensoukyoku Series.
